Description

Shed Cast was created for shed hunters by shed hunters. Shed Cast delivers a platform to share shed hunting stories, tip and tactics, and all things shed hunting. Tune in to hear from the many guests who share the same passion and talk all things shed hunting.

On this episode of Shed Cast, host Dale Liversedge discusses shed hunting in Oklahoma with Seth Bowman, a popular TikTok creator known for his engaging outdoor content. Seth shares his journey into shed hunting, techniques specific to Oklahoma, and the importance of understanding deer behavior. The conversation covers the differences between public and private land hunting, strategies for success, and the significance of planning and preparation. Seth also emphasizes the value of transition areas and food sources in locating sheds, while providing tips for gaining permission on private land and encouraging new hunters to embrace the adventure.

In this episode of Shedcast, host Dale Liversedge speaks with Ben Leger from Canada about the fascinating world of shed hunting and the benefits of training dogs. Ben shares his personal journey into shed hunting, the training techniques he uses for his dogs, and the importance of obedience and confidence in successful shed hunting. The conversation also touches on the ethical considerations of shed hunting, the various dog breeds that can be trained for this purpose, and the resources available for aspiring shed dog trainers. Ben emphasizes the joy of involving family in shed hunting and the benefits of using dogs to cover more ground and find antlers more efficiently.
